Arab Weather - Iraq has been affected since last night, Thursday/Friday night, by a state of atmospheric instability that resulted in the proliferation of clouds and rainfall of varying intensity in the western regions of the country, specifically Anbar Governorate and the Rutba region, accompanied by hail showers, especially in the areas adjacent to the Jordanian-Iraqi border at dawn today.

Cold winds in the lower atmosphere in the coming hours and freezing rain showers expected

God willing, the country is expected to be affected more during the coming hours, specifically in the afternoon hours, by the rainy conditions and the upper air depression will pass, accompanied by the flow of very cold and Siberian winds in the lower layers of the atmosphere, where the amount of clouds will increase and rain will fall on wide areas, including the capital Baghdad. The rain will be heavy at times, especially in the northern regions, and will be in the form of snow on the northern mountain peaks in the border areas adjacent to Iran and Kuwait.

Due to the flow of cold Siberian winds in the lower layers of the atmosphere, it is expected that the rainfall will turn into freezing rain or snow showers mixed with rain from time to time in some areas, especially the northern and western ones, during the passage of the upper air depression.

Very cold weather and the need for heating and wearing heavy clothing

God willing, the weather is expected to get colder, especially in the evening and night hours, and the weather will be cold to very cold in various regions, with the need to wear heavy winter clothes and use heating methods, God willing.
